Robert Luciano of VGI Partners says Australian retailers should be concerned by Amazon’s purchase of grocery retailer Whole Foods. Amazon announced on 16 June 2017 that it will acquire the US grocery retailer for $US13.7 billion ($A18 billion), and that Whole Foods will continue to trade under its current name. Luciano suggests that the purchase represents a major evolvement in Amazon’s business model. Amazon is due to commence operating in Australia in 2018, and it is expected to have a major impact on the earnings of local retailers.
